國家工信部網(wǎng)站備案實(shí)名:湖北自考網(wǎng) 為考生提供湖北自考信息服務(wù),僅供學(xué)習(xí)交流使用,官方信息以湖北教育考試院為準(zhǔn)。
湖北自考在線 湖北學(xué)位英語培訓(xùn)班 湖北成人高考報(bào)名 湖北自考視頻免費(fèi)領(lǐng)取

自考“計(jì)算機(jī)組成原理”串講資料(7) -自考串講筆記

湖北自考網(wǎng) 來源: 時(shí)間:2008-11-08 15:42:37

  第7章 輸入輸出系統(tǒng)

  一、名詞解釋:

  歷年真題:

 ?。?001年)9.DMA 方式:直接存儲器訪問,直接依靠硬件實(shí)現(xiàn)主存與外設(shè)之間的數(shù)據(jù)直接傳輸,傳輸過程本身不需CPU程序干預(yù)。

 ?。?002年)5.I/O接口:是指連接主機(jī)和外圍設(shè)備的邏輯部件。

  (2003年)20.中斷屏蔽:CPU處理一個(gè)中斷的過程中,對其他一些外部設(shè)備的中斷進(jìn)行阻止。

 ?。?004年)17.統(tǒng)一編址:將輸入輸出設(shè)備中控制寄存器、數(shù)據(jù)寄存器、狀態(tài)寄存器等與內(nèi)存單元一樣看待,將它們和內(nèi)存單元聯(lián)合在一起編排地址,用訪問內(nèi)存的指令來訪問輸入輸出設(shè)備接口的某個(gè)寄存器,從而實(shí)現(xiàn)數(shù)據(jù)的輸入輸出。

 ?。?005年)25.通道程序:通道命令構(gòu)成通道程序。在通道程序的控制下,通道對外圍設(shè)備進(jìn)行數(shù)據(jù)傳輸控制。

  近年以來每年考本章的名詞稱解釋,所以第五章的名稱解釋是考試的重點(diǎn)。這里給大家列出了本章的名詞解釋,大家要熟悉一下,這都是本章的基本概念,有利于做名稱解釋、選擇題、改錯(cuò)題和填空題。

  1.統(tǒng)一編址:將輸入輸出設(shè)備中控制寄存器、數(shù)據(jù)寄存器、狀態(tài)寄存器等與內(nèi)存單元一樣看待,將它們和內(nèi)存單元聯(lián)合在一起編排地址,用訪問內(nèi)存的指令來訪問輸入輸出設(shè)備接口的某個(gè)寄存器,從而實(shí)現(xiàn)數(shù)據(jù)的輸入輸出。

  2.單獨(dú)編址:將輸入輸出設(shè)備中控制寄存器、數(shù)據(jù)寄存器、狀態(tài)寄存器單獨(dú)編排地址,用專門的控制信號進(jìn)行輸入輸出操作。

  3.單級中斷:CPU在執(zhí)行中斷服務(wù)程序的過程中禁止所有其他外部中斷。

  4.多級中斷:CPU在執(zhí)行中斷服務(wù)程序的過程中可以響應(yīng)級別更高的中斷請求。

  5.中斷屏蔽:CPU處理一個(gè)中斷的過程中,對其他一些外部設(shè)備的中斷進(jìn)行阻止。

  6.DMA:直接存儲器訪問,直接依靠硬件實(shí)現(xiàn)主存與外設(shè)之間的數(shù)據(jù)直接傳輸,傳輸過程本身不需CPU程序干預(yù)。

  7.現(xiàn)場保護(hù):CPU在響應(yīng)中斷請求時(shí),將程序計(jì)數(shù)器和有關(guān)寄存器內(nèi)容等系統(tǒng)的狀態(tài)信息存儲起來,以使中斷處理結(jié)束之后能恢復(fù)原來的狀態(tài)繼續(xù)執(zhí)行程序,稱為現(xiàn)場保護(hù)。

  8.中斷向量:外設(shè)在向CPU發(fā)出中斷請求時(shí),由該設(shè)備通過輸入輸出總線主動向CPU發(fā)出一個(gè)識別代碼,這個(gè)識別代碼通常稱為中斷向量。

  9.自陷:當(dāng)CPU出現(xiàn)有算術(shù)操作異常、非法指令、越權(quán)操作和訪存中的異常等某種內(nèi)部情況時(shí)自己引起的中斷稱為自陷。

  10.軟件中斷:由自陷指令引起的中斷稱為軟件中斷,又稱為系統(tǒng)調(diào)用。

  11.通道命令:通道用于執(zhí)行輸入輸出操作的指令,也叫通道控制字(CCW)。

  二、選擇填空題:

  歷年真題:

  2000年:

  7.設(shè)置中斷排隊(duì)判優(yōu)邏輯的目的是(?。?/p>

  A.產(chǎn)生中斷源編碼

  B.使同時(shí)提出的請求中的優(yōu)先級別最高者,得到及時(shí)響應(yīng)

  C.使CPU能方便地轉(zhuǎn)入中斷服務(wù)子程序

  D.提高中斷響應(yīng)速度

  「分析」:當(dāng)有多個(gè)中斷請求同時(shí)出現(xiàn),中斷服務(wù)系統(tǒng)必須能從中選出當(dāng)前最需要給予響應(yīng)的最重要的中斷請求,這就需要預(yù)先對所有的中斷進(jìn)行優(yōu)先級排隊(duì),這個(gè)工作可由中斷優(yōu)先級判斷邏輯來完成,排隊(duì)的規(guī)則可由軟件通過對中斷屏蔽寄存器進(jìn)行設(shè)置來確定。

  「答案」:B

  10.通道程序在內(nèi)存中的首地址由( )給出。

  「分析」:CPU使用通道進(jìn)行一個(gè)輸入輸出操作時(shí),先發(fā)出一個(gè)通道啟動信號。通道收到啟動信號后,到指定的內(nèi)存單元中取通道地址字,并將其放入通道地址寄存器中。此通道地址字為通道程序在內(nèi)存中的首地址。

  「答案」:通道地址字

  11.在不改變中斷響應(yīng)次序的條件下,通過( )可以改變中斷處理次序。

  「分析」:在多重中斷系統(tǒng)中,可以通過設(shè)置中斷優(yōu)先級來決定各個(gè)中斷的級別。在實(shí)際的計(jì)算機(jī)系統(tǒng)中是通過CPU內(nèi)部的一個(gè)中斷屏蔽字寄存器來實(shí)現(xiàn)對不同中斷的分別禁止的,這個(gè)寄存器可在中斷處理程序中重新設(shè)置,這樣就可以改變原有的中斷優(yōu)先級別。

  「答案」:改寫中斷屏蔽字

  2005年:

  16.采用DMA方式傳送數(shù)據(jù)是由DMA接口來控制數(shù)據(jù)在   和   之間傳輸。

  「分析」:DMA是指直接存儲器訪問,是利用一個(gè)專門的接口電路將計(jì)算機(jī)的主存儲器與高速的外設(shè)相連接,當(dāng)計(jì)算機(jī)要與外設(shè)進(jìn)行數(shù)據(jù)傳送時(shí),由CPU發(fā)出一個(gè)控制信號啟動DMA之后由DMA來控制完成外設(shè)與主存儲器之間的數(shù)據(jù)傳送,其傳送方式為數(shù)據(jù)塊 (數(shù)據(jù)成組)傳送,傳送過程為連續(xù)的,中間沒有停止等待的時(shí)間,所以數(shù)據(jù)的傳送速度較高。

  「答案」:外設(shè)  主存儲器

  三、改錯(cuò)題:

  歷年真題:

  (2000年)7.對I/O數(shù)據(jù)傳送的控制方式,可分為程序中斷控制方式和獨(dú)立編址傳送控制方式兩種。

  「分析」:對1/O數(shù)據(jù)傳送的控制方式,可分為程序直接控制方式、程序中斷控制方式、DMA控制方式、通道控制方式等。程序中斷控制方式只是其中的一種方法,獨(dú)立編址是指對1/O設(shè)備的控制寄存器、數(shù)據(jù)寄存器、狀態(tài)寄存器等單獨(dú)進(jìn)行地址編排,使用專門的指令對其進(jìn)行操作,可用在各種數(shù)據(jù)傳送的控制方式中。

  「答案」:對1/O數(shù)據(jù)傳送的控制方式,可分為:程序直接控制方式、程序中斷方式、DMA方式、通道控制方式等。

 ?。?002)5.對外設(shè)統(tǒng)一編址是指給每個(gè)外設(shè)設(shè)置一個(gè)地址碼。

  「分析」:CPU與外設(shè)之間的信息傳送是通過硬件接口來實(shí)現(xiàn)的,各種外設(shè)的硬件接口上又都包含有多個(gè)寄存器,如控制寄存器、數(shù)據(jù)寄存器、狀態(tài)寄存器等。統(tǒng)一編址是將外設(shè)接口上的各種寄存器等同于內(nèi)存儲器的存儲單元,通過使用訪問內(nèi)存單元的指令來訪問外設(shè)接口上的各個(gè)寄存器,這樣就可以使用訪存指令來訪問外設(shè),輸入輸出操作簡單,程序設(shè)計(jì)比較簡便。由于外設(shè)接口上的寄存器種類和數(shù)量通常不止一個(gè),所以一個(gè)外設(shè)至少對應(yīng)一個(gè)以上的內(nèi)存地址。

  「答案」:對外設(shè)統(tǒng)一編址是將外設(shè)接口上的寄存器等內(nèi)存單元,給每個(gè)外設(shè)設(shè)置至少一個(gè)地址碼。

  (2003年)25.在常見的微機(jī)系統(tǒng)中,磁盤常采用通道方式與主存交換信息。

  「分析」:通道傳輸方式是采用通道處理器將多個(gè)輸入輸出設(shè)備與CPU和主存儲器相連接,并控制其信息的傳輸,主要用于大型計(jì)算機(jī)以及網(wǎng)絡(luò)服務(wù)器等含有許多輸入輸出設(shè)備并對輸入輸出有較高要求的場合;而DMA方式是采用DMA控制器將外圍設(shè)備與主存儲器相連接,并控制其信息的傳輸,主要用于微型計(jì)算機(jī)中外設(shè)與主存之間需要成批傳輸數(shù)據(jù)的場合,如微機(jī)系統(tǒng)中磁盤與主存之間的數(shù)據(jù)傳輸。

  「答案」:在常見的微機(jī)系統(tǒng)中,磁盤常采用DMA方式與主存交換數(shù)據(jù)。

 ?。?004年)25.通道就是一組輸入輸出傳送線。

  「分析」:通道是一種比DMA更高級的I/O控制部件,具有更強(qiáng)的獨(dú)立處理數(shù)據(jù)的輸入/輸出功能,能同時(shí)控制多臺同類型或不同類型的設(shè)備。它在一定的硬件基礎(chǔ)上,利用通道程序?qū)崿F(xiàn)對1/O的控制,更多地免去了CPU的介入,使系統(tǒng)的并行性能更高。

  「答案」:通道是具有更強(qiáng)的獨(dú)立處理數(shù)據(jù)的輸入/輸出功能,能同時(shí)控制多臺同類型或不同類型的設(shè)備。

  四、簡答題:

  歷年真題:

  2000年:

  7.以DMA方式實(shí)現(xiàn)傳送,大致可分為哪幾個(gè)階段?(3分)

  「答案」:

  ① DMA傳送前的預(yù)置階段(DMA初始化);

  ② 數(shù)據(jù)傳送階段(DMA傳送);

 ?、?傳送后的結(jié)束處理。

  2001年:

  2.何謂中斷方式?它主要應(yīng)用在什么場合?請舉二例。

  「答案」:

 ?、?中斷方式指:CPU在接到隨機(jī)產(chǎn)生的中斷請求信號后,暫停原程序,轉(zhuǎn)去執(zhí)行相應(yīng)的中斷處理程序,以處理該隨機(jī)事件,處理完畢后返回并繼續(xù)執(zhí)行原程序;

  ② 主要應(yīng)用于處理復(fù)雜隨機(jī)事件、控制中低速1/O;

  ③ 例:打印機(jī)控制,故障處理。

  3.在 DMA 方式預(yù)處理(初始化)階段, CPU 通過程序送出哪些信息?

  「答案」:

  向DMA控制器及I/O接口(分離模式或集成模式均可)分別送出以下信息:

 ?、?測試設(shè)備狀態(tài),預(yù)置DMA控制器工作方式;

  ② 主存緩沖區(qū)首址,交換量,傳送方向;

  ③ 設(shè)備尋址信息,啟動讀/寫。

  6.中斷接口一般包含哪些基本組成?簡要說明它們的作用。

  「答案」:

  ① 地址譯碼。選取接口中有關(guān)寄存器,也就是選擇了I/O設(shè)備。

  ② 命令字/狀態(tài)字寄存器。供CPU輸出控制命令,調(diào)回接口與設(shè)備的狀態(tài)信息。

  ③ 數(shù)據(jù)緩存。提供數(shù)據(jù)緩沖,實(shí)現(xiàn)速度匹配。

 ?、?控制邏輯。如中斷控制邏輯、與設(shè)備特性相關(guān)的控制邏輯等。

  2002年:

  5.何謂DAM方式?說明它的適用場合。

  「答案」:

  定義:由DMA控制器控制系統(tǒng)總線,直接依靠硬件實(shí)現(xiàn)主存與I/O設(shè)備之間的數(shù)據(jù)直傳,傳送期間不需要CPU程序干預(yù)。

  適用場合:高速、批量數(shù)據(jù)的簡單傳送。

  6.何謂多重中斷?如何保證它的實(shí)現(xiàn)?

  「答案」:

  多重中斷:CPU在響應(yīng)處理中斷過程中,允許響應(yīng)處理更高級別的中斷請求,這種方式稱為多重中斷。

  實(shí)現(xiàn)方法:在中斷服務(wù)程序的起始部分用一段程序來保存現(xiàn)場、送新屏蔽字以屏蔽同級別和低級別的中斷請求、然后開中斷,這樣CPU就可響應(yīng)更高級別的中斷請求,實(shí)現(xiàn)多重中斷。

  2003年:

  30.簡述外圍設(shè)備接口的主要功能。(新教材取消了這一內(nèi)容)

  31.試對程序中斷方式和 DMA 方式各分別舉出二種應(yīng)用例子。

  「答案」:

  中斷方式常用于打印機(jī)輸出、鍵盤輸入等;

  DMA

結(jié)束
本文標(biāo)簽
特別聲明:1.凡本網(wǎng)注明稿件來源為“湖北自考網(wǎng)”的,轉(zhuǎn)載必須注明“稿件來源:湖北自考網(wǎng)(trillionsbussines.com)”,違者將依法追究責(zé)任;
2.部分稿件來源于網(wǎng)絡(luò),如有不實(shí)或侵權(quán),請聯(lián)系我們溝通解決。最新官方信息請以湖北省教育考試院及各教育官網(wǎng)為準(zhǔn)!
限時(shí),免費(fèi)獲取學(xué)歷提升方案

已幫助10w萬+意向?qū)W歷提升用戶成功上岸

  • 毛澤東思想概論

    毛澤東思想概論

    培訓(xùn)優(yōu)勢:課時(shí)考點(diǎn)精講+刷題+沖刺,熟練應(yīng)對考試題型。全程督促學(xué)習(xí),安排好學(xué)習(xí)計(jì)劃。 毛澤東思想概論...自考培訓(xùn)
  • 英語二

    英語二

    本課程既是一門語言實(shí)踐課程,也是拓寬知識、了解世界文化的重要素質(zhì)課程,它以培養(yǎng)學(xué)習(xí)者的綜合語言應(yīng)用能力為目標(biāo),使他們在學(xué)習(xí)、工作和社會交往中能夠使用英語進(jìn)行有效的交流。 英語二...自考培訓(xùn)
  • 馬克思主義基本原理概論

    馬克思主義基本原理概論

    本書包括兩個(gè)部分:自學(xué)考試大綱和基本原理。主要內(nèi)容有,馬克思主義是關(guān)于工人階級和人類解放的科學(xué),物質(zhì)世界及其發(fā)展規(guī)律,認(rèn)識的本質(zhì)及其規(guī)律,人類社會及其發(fā)展規(guī)律,資本主義的形成及其發(fā)展,資本主義發(fā)展的歷史進(jìn)程,社會主義社會及其進(jìn)程,共產(chǎn)主義社會及其進(jìn)程等。 馬克思主義基本原理概論...自考培訓(xùn)
  • 思想道德修養(yǎng)與法律基礎(chǔ)

    思想道德修養(yǎng)與法律基礎(chǔ)

    《思想道德修養(yǎng)與法律基礎(chǔ)》課具有鮮明的政治性、思想性、理論性、針對性、科學(xué)性、知識性以及實(shí)踐性和修養(yǎng)性。它包羅政治、思想、道德、心理本質(zhì)、學(xué)習(xí)成才和法律本質(zhì)等內(nèi)容,指導(dǎo)和回答大學(xué)生在人生、抱負(fù)、信念等方面遍及關(guān)心和迫切需要解決的問題。 思想道德修養(yǎng)與法律基礎(chǔ)...自考培訓(xùn)
  • 中國近代史綱要

    中國近代史綱要

    “中國近現(xiàn)代史綱要”全國高等教育自學(xué)考試指定教材,依據(jù)中央審定的普通高等學(xué)?!爸袊F(xiàn)代史綱要”編寫大綱以及馬克思主義理論研究和建設(shè)工程重點(diǎn)教材《中國近現(xiàn)代史綱要》,結(jié)合自學(xué)考試的特點(diǎn)設(shè)計(jì)了十章,集中講述1840年鴉片戰(zhàn)爭爆發(fā)一直到2007年中國共產(chǎn)黨第十七次全國代表大會召開的160多年的中國近現(xiàn)代歷史。 中國近代史綱要...自考培訓(xùn)
微信公眾號 考試交流群
湖北自考網(wǎng)微信公眾號

掃一掃關(guān)注微信公眾號

隨時(shí)獲取湖北省自考政策、通知、公告以及各類學(xué)習(xí)資料、學(xué)習(xí)方法、課程。